    Story of Prince Meghkumar:

    Prince Meghkumar was the son of King Shrenik (also known as Bimbisara) of Magadh and Queen Dharini. Meghkumar grew up in great luxury and enjoyed all the pleasures of royal life. He was known for his intelligence, beauty, and valor.

    One day, Lord Mahavira, the 24th Tirthankara, visited Rajgriha, the capital city. Prince Meghkumar, along with his father, went to listen to Mahavira’s sermon. Deeply influenced by the Lord’s teachings on non-attachment and the cycle of birth and death (samsara), Meghkumar developed a strong desire for renunciation (diksha).

    However, his mother, Queen Dharini, was not ready to let her only son become a monk. She pleaded with him to wait for at least seven more days before taking diksha. Meghkumar agreed, out of respect for his mother.

    During these seven days, Queen Dharini arranged for Meghkumar to enjoy every possible luxury and pleasure, hoping he would change his mind. She invited beautiful dancers and musicians to entertain him. Despite being surrounded by all kinds of sensual pleasures, Meghkumar remained detached, his mind fixed on the higher goal of spiritual liberation.

    On the eighth day, Meghkumar approached his parents, renounced all his royal comforts, and took diksha at the hands of Lord Mahavira. He endured many hardships as a monk but remained steadfast in his resolve. Due to his strong determination and detachment, Meghkumar soon attained Kevalgyan (omniscience) and ultimately achieved liberation (moksha).

    Significance in Jainism:

    • Meghkumar’s story is frequently told to inspire detachment from worldly pleasures.
    • It emphasizes the importance of right faith, right knowledge, and right conduct (ratnatraya) in Jainism.
    • The story also highlights the power of spiritual resolve over material temptations.

    This tale is often recited during Jain festivals and is a popular subject in Jain literature and art, reminding followers of the ultimate goal of liberation through renunciation and spiritual discipline.
